Traitement d'image : niveaux de gris Ainsi, de par cette réciprocité, l'analyse d'image et la synthèse d'image sont des disciplines scientifiques dites « duales ». Thresholding We will use this field image as an example for the whole process of image processing. Seuils simples Filtre moyenneur¶ Le filtre moyenneur est une opération de traitement d'images . Elle dispose de nombreux algorithmes de segmentation, de manipulation des couleurs, de . Ouvrage à partir de 24,00 € TTC Module à partir de 3,20 € TTC. Nous n'allons pas ici expliquer comment sont représentées les couleurs. Le deuxième argument est la valeur de seuil utilisée pour classer les valeurs de pixels. mask3 = cv.cvtColor (mask, cv.COLOR_GRAY2BGR) # 3 channel mask. Le . PDF Traitement d'images et de vidéos avec OpenCV 4 - D-BookeR Traitement vidéosModifier Cette bibliothèque s'est imposée comme un . OpenCV (pour Open Computer Vision) est une bibliothèque graphique libre, initialement développée par Intel, spécialisée dans le traitement d'images en temps réel. OpenCV : segmentation par seuillage - Acervo Lima Seuillage local par hystérésis. You can use OpenCV to convert a BGR image matrix to HSV. Traitement d'image OpenCV | Traitement d'images avec OpenCV Pour quantifier une image de micrographie avec ImageJ par exemple, on commence en général par transformer cette image initialement en 3 couleurs RGB en une image en niveau de gris (Greyscale avec 256 niveaux, soit 8 bits ou 2 8).On réalise ensuite une opération de seuillage (thresholding) qui permet de ne conserver que les niveaux de gris permettant d'isoler au mieux les particules ou . Puis je devrais appliquer la transformé de Hough pour detecter le cercle que j'ai entouré en rouge sur le screenshot. Un plus Détection des contours 12. Pour appliquer ce masque à notre image couleur d'origine, nous devons convertir le masque en une image à 3 canaux car l'image couleur d'origine est une image à 3 canaux. Il existe de nombreux algorithmes pour effectuer le lissage. J'ai fait un seuillage sur une image et je veux étiqueter les contours en vert, mais ils ne s'affichent pas en vert car mon image est en noir et blanc. OpenCV fournit un Fonction HouhLines dans laquelle la valeur seuil doit passer. Une des facettes du Traitement ou de l'Analyse d'Image est exactement le contraire (cf. OpenCV fournit différents types de seuillage qui est donné par le quatrième paramètre de la fonction. hsv_img = cv2. cv::Mat img = cv::imread ( "image.jpg", CV_LOAD_IMAGE_GRAYSCALE); cv::Mat bw = img > 128 ; De cette façon, tous les pixels de la matrice supérieure à 128 maintenant sont . Les Bases du Traitement d'Images - Developpez.com Voici quelques exemples : Le Tresholding (seuillage) d'une image permet de définir une valeur de pixel (correspondant à une couleur) qui servira de seuil. À partir d'une image en niveau de gris, le seuillage d'image peut être utilisé pour créer une image comportant uniquement deux valeurs, noir ou blanc (monochrome)1. setTrackbarPos, Création d'une glissière Seuillage, Organisation en modules d'OpenCV, Seuillage d'image, Méthode de seuillage Sift, Réaliser une caméra panoramique Size, Type Size Slice, Boucle d'acquisition et d'affichage, Accéder à une ligne, une colonne ou à une zone Sobel, Calcul du gradient et du module du gradient de l'image ☞ au vieux singe répertoire Python Bowen Introduction. Seuil RVB rapide en Python (éventuellement du code OpenCV intelligent ... 666 vues. Pour une description détaillée, voir le code suivant pour une implémentation complète. Nous avons vu dans le précédent billet comment récupérer le flux d'une vidéo ou d'une webcam.Avant d'afficher ce dernier, il est possible de faire subir aux images tout un tas de traitements (niark). voix -1 . classes . Seuillage des images. Dans «le traitement de seuil de la fonction de traitement de seuil OpenCV cas d'image couleur 32 bits » a introduit la fonction de seuil, mais le traitement de seuil d'image de seuil pour certaines images inégalement éclairées, cette méthode de segmentation de seuil global n'obtient pas de bons résultats. Introduction au traitement des images et à la stéréo-vision La société de robotique Willow Garage et la société ItSeez se sont succédé au support de cette bibliothèque. Bien que j'aie essayé beaucoup de techniques de suppression du bruit, mais lorsque l'image a changé, les techniques que j'ai utilisées ont échoué. Le seuillage d'une image (en niveaux de gris) vous permet de sélectionner uniquement les pixels dont la valeur est supérieure à un certain seuil. Ces transformations sont les plus simples, elles apparaissent dans presque tous les processus de traitement et d'analyse d'images : en pré-traitement pour normaliser l'image, ou en post-traitement pour améliorer la visualisation. Youssef EL ACHHAB - ib - groupe Cegos - LinkedIn Le seuil est le vote minimum pour qu'une ligne soit considérée. Et bien c'est très simple avec les histogrammes d'images: Une image en noir et Blanc a un histogramme très basique (binaire) qui ne comporte que des valeurs O ou 1 (pas de nuances sur 24 bits par exemple) : Utilisation de masques pour appliquer différents seuils à différentes ... Détection des contours - Seuillage local par hystérésis La transformée de Hough. Comme nous l'avons vu lors de la troisième partie intitulée « Introduction aux Différents Types de Segmentation » un Contour est une zone de transition filiforme entre deux zones homogènes de l'image, appelées Régions, conformément au schéma de la figure n° 1 (a).Pour comprendre ces notions, il est intéressant d'étudier le profil de l'intensité de l'image dans la direction . python - image correcte seuillage pour le préparer pour l'OCR en ... Une autre opération rigolote consiste à seuiller notre image. Morphologie mathématique et Deep Learning - MetalBlog Pour extraire les pixels de chaque objet, nous allons utiliser la technique de rétroprojection d'histogramme.Pour extraire la bille rouge, on utilise son histogramme hist1, c'est-à-dire un histogramme construit à partir d'un rectangle inscrit dans la bille.La rétroprojection consiste à construire une image en niveaux de gris, en remplaçant chaque . Le seuillage d'image consiste à remplacer un à un les pixels d'une image à l'aide d'une valeur seuil fixée (par exemple 127). D. Notions d'histogramme et de seuillage L'histogramme d'une image est une fonction qui donne la fréquence d'apparition de chaque niveau de gris (ou couleurs) da Anonyme. Suivi d'un objet coloré dans une vidéo - f-legrand.fr Lecture. Options: Consultation en ligne Consultation en ligne - Téléchargement Version imprimée. Donc les pixels sont déjà triés en deux populations. À partir d'une image réelle, le traitement d'image vise à en comprendre le contenu. ; • imgcodecs pour la lecture et l'écriture d'images; La gamme de teintes d'OpenCV est de 1° à 180° au lieu des 1° à 360° habituels. Une introduction cool à la fonction threshold OpenCV - Il est possible de seuiller manuellement une image en utilisant la fonction cv2.thresold d'OpenCV. img = cv2.imread('myImage.jpg', 0): charge une image en niveaux de gris, même si l'image dans le fichier était en couleurs. Traitement d'images et de vidéos avec OpenCV 4 - D-BookeR Il suffit d'inverser le masque et de l'appliquer à une image d'arrière-plan de même taille, puis de combiner l'arrière-plan et le premier plan.Un pro de cette solution est que l'arrière-plan pourrait être n'importe quoi (même une autre image). Faire afficher une image 4. NB : Cette technique permet de produire une image utilisable facilement pour de la gravure laser. en préparation d'une détection de contours (voir partie 3). Donc, j'utilise opencv seuil de la fonction: Seuillage / classification Méthodes de division et fusion Méthodes d'agrégation 4 Segmentation : Approche frontière 5 Autres approches de la segmentation.
Train électrique Hornby 1960,
Can I Schedule A Message In Viber,
Meuble Tv Atlanta Occasion,
Aspirateur Moosoo Avis,
Tout S'explique Maria Del Rio Robe,
Articles S